About this facility
The Timbers Of Cass County is a Medicare- and Medicaid-certified nursing home in Dowagiac, Cass County, Michigan, with 108 certified beds and an average of 100.1 residents. The facility is organized as a for-profit limited liability company and has been certified since December 2010. It is part of the Atrium Centers chain, which operates 26 facilities nationally with an average rating of 3.0 stars.
According to CMS Care Compare, the facility holds an overall rating of 2 out of 5 stars, below the Michigan state average of 3.12. The health inspection rating is also 2 stars, while the quality measure rating and staffing rating are each 4 stars.
Nurse staffing totals 3.46 hours per resident per day, including 0.69 RN hours per resident per day. Nursing staff turnover is reported at 28.9%.
Regarding the penalty record, CMS reports no federal fines on record for this facility (0 fines, $0.00 total) and no payment denials. No abuse icon is displayed by CMS for this facility, and it is not currently listed under CMS's Special Focus program, which is reserved for facilities CMS identifies as persistently underperforming and subject to increased inspection scrutiny.
Ownership has not changed within the past 12 months according to CMS records, so current ratings should reflect the present operator.
